Borr Drilling CFO Resigns

Wednesday, November 6, 2019

Drilling contractor Borr Drilling announced that Rune Magnus Lundetræ will step down from his position as Chief Financial Officer. 

Lundetræ, who has been with the company since 2016, will continue in his position while the company finds a replacement, the company said.
